Welcome to the Fennwick Plugins program. When your handler runs on our Quillstream serverless runtime, the first invocation after a period of inactivity incurs a cold start: the runtime provisions an isolate, loads your bundle, and executes initialization code. Keep top-level imports lean and defer heavy setup until first request. For measured cold-start budgets per tier and optimization guidance, see the page linked below.

operations page: https://jira.qorvelsys.internal/browse/pages/browse/pages

## Idempotency Keys for Payment Retries (Lumopay)

Every retry of a charge request must reuse the original idempotency key; generating a new key on retry can produce duplicate charges. Keys are scoped per merchant and expire after 48 hours. Reviewers should verify keys are derived server-side, never from client input. The full key-generation specification and threat model are maintained on the internal page.

dashboard of kaguf-tawip = https://vault.merlaqsys.test/issue

### Rotation Cadence

Keywick rotates service secrets on a rolling schedule rather than all at once, to avoid thundering-herd re-auth against the Bramblehold vault. Each rotation acquires a lease, swaps the secret, then holds a grace window so in-flight callers can drain. If you change any timing, keep the grace window longer than the longest client cache TTL. The defaults shipped to all environments are listed below.

constants for yajog-tajep:
QUOTAS = {
    "fenir": 536,
    "normir": 443,
    "fenath": 793,
}

## Account Recovery — Trailnote Offline Mode

When a surveyor's Trailnote app has been offline for 30+ days, their local credentials expire and sync refuses to resume. Don't make them wipe the device — all their unsynced field data lives there! Instead, open the support console, pick "Offline Reinstate," and enter their handle. The console will ask for the support team's shared recovery passphrase before issuing a reinstatement token. Use the one below.

unlock words, bagaf-fajeg: zorael-kelax-fraath-quenix-eliok-sileth-aldmir-wenir-druiel